Output f09d3d1d71699bc122bc33c84f5d1191f088eb92a8dddc2085a5f15d0a3820de:4

value
588607829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b8f4ae787d62f6bce7bc17de8b12f3a6ea3944 OP_EQUAL
address
MSevKi4hM68Mr7KAh7sqeFvkz2PDLuyyga
transaction
f09d3d1d71699bc122bc33c84f5d1191f088eb92a8dddc2085a5f15d0a3820de
spent
true